      The Investigative Committee did not open a criminal case after the death of former participant of the scandalous TV show "Dom-2" (18+) Polina Malinina. This was reported to NIA "Nizhny Novgorod" by the press service of the Investigative Department of the Investigative Committee of Russia for the Nizhny Novgorod Region.

      The department said there were no grounds to initiate a case because there was no criminal element in the death of the Nizhny Novgorod resident.

      Recall that the former "Dom-2" participant was found dead in an apartment. The body of the 24-year-old woman lay there for several days until friends raised the alarm. Footage from the building's entrance cameras showed that the day before Malinina entered the building with a man, and in the morning he left without her. A source in law enforcement told NIA "Nizhny Novgorod" that Malinina was poisoned by drugs.

      Notably, Malinina headed the local branch of the MaryWay modeling agency, whose activities drew the attention of law enforcement. A criminal fraud case was opened. More than 300 people from nine Russian regions were recognized as victims. They appealed to the head of the Investigative Committee, Alexander Bastrykin, asking for help with the investigation.
